The Dalles City Council gave the go-ahead to do roof structure modifications for the Sorosis Reservoir. It will cost about $1.4 million for the project…which became a necessity when deterioration and metal loss on many of the interior roof rafters and bolts due to corrosion was discovered during interior painting of the reservoir. Mayor Rich Mays says this work has impacts on other parts of the municipal water infrastructure…which will need improvements to prepare for Google’s new data centers. Work on the Sorosis Reservoir has to be done in the winter months…and it’s to be completed by April of 2024.
